Source: Google Books: CRC World Dictionary (Regional names)

Graminha de araraquara in Brazil is the name of a plant defined with Eustachys distichophylla in various botanical sources. This page contains potential references in Ayurveda, modern medicine, and other folk traditions or local practices It has the synonym Chloris argentina (Hack.) Lillo & Parodi (among others).
